Output f38dc14db5ebdf5149bfaaa6dcb74bcaff43ea73d1be3a92d8ab7beeb381eb03:4

value
19240824
script pubkey
OP_0 OP_PUSHBYTES_20 faecbfbd1ad09c107097c2a870b47df1538e1d9d
address
bc1qltktl0g66zwpquyhc258pdra79fcu8vajv869u
transaction
f38dc14db5ebdf5149bfaaa6dcb74bcaff43ea73d1be3a92d8ab7beeb381eb03
confirmations
389996
spent
true